Atiku Rebukes Tinubu’s Dismissal of Nigeria’s Security Crisis
Former Vice President Atiku Abubakar has accused President Bola Tinubu of treating the nation’s security challenges with “insensitive political rhetoric.” He criticised comments suggesting that growing violence would not affect the president’s tenure, arguing they ignore the human suffering behind the statistics. Atiku highlighted estimates that thousands of Nigerians have died in attacks since 2023, calling for empathy and urgent action. He warned that public trust erodes when leaders offer assurances instead of results. He also urged the government to stop silencing critics and focus on concrete reforms in the security sector. With the 2027 elections looming, Atiku insisted that Nigerians will judge leadership by outcomes, not promises.
